Seluna
Seluna is thought to be among the most ancient of Kelios' deities, most humans in Kelios consider the moon in the sky to literally be the goddess gazing down on the world. She is the goddess of stars and navigation as well as motherhood and reproductive cycles. She is seen as a calm power, frequently venerated by female humans as well as by a mix of other folk: navigators and sailors, those who work honestly at night, those seeking protection in the dark, the lost, and the questing. There are many legends about Seluna, chief among them being the tale of the battle against Shar. Shar is referred to as Seluna's 'Dark Sister', but their is no family relation between them. Milk, a symbol of motherhood, is used in many rites performed by the worshipers of Seluna, as are trances and meditation.
